- ベストアンサー
※ ChatGPTを利用し、要約された質問です(原文:コンストラクタの記述について ―引数を持ったクラスを継承する場合―)
コンストラクタの記述について ―引数を持ったクラスを継承する場合―
このQ&Aのポイント
- ActionScript3.0でのクラスの継承において、コンストラクタの記述についての問題が発生しています。
- 引数を持ったクラスを継承する場合、コンストラクタの記述方法に注意が必要です。
- コンストラクタに引数がある場合、親クラスのデフォルトコンストラクタの定義が必要となります。
- みんなの回答 (2)
- 専門家の回答
質問者が選んだベストアンサー
trace("子クラス, ", str, inNum); を super(inNum); に書き換えたら、出ることはでますね。 「親クラス, 親クラスのプロパティ 200」とでますが^^; 参考になりますか?
その他の回答 (1)
- taka451213
- ベストアンサー率47% (436/922)
回答No.1
こんばんは。 AS3はよくわからんのだが・・・、 >No default constructor found in base class というメッセージから判断するに、 親クラスに、 public function Parent():void { } を追加すればいいのかな? そもそもオーバーロードできないのかな?
質問者
お礼
ご回答ありがとうございました! 非常に助かりました。 メッセージ、ちゃんと読めるようにならないといけないですね......
お礼
1年以上遅れてしまいましたが、 ご回答いただきありがとうございました! 当時、ものすごくテンパっていたので お返事せずそのまま忘れてしまいました……。